I just set a >>> delay between the add tiddler and setting the field. It worked as >>> expected. Is adding a tiddler async? I briefly thought about that >>> originally but didn't test until now. >>> >>> No, when you call addTiddler() the tiddler is changed immediately. The >>> part that is asynchronous is the refresh cycle: it is triggered via >>> setTimeout() arranged so that multiple tiddler store modifications will >>> trigger a single refresh cycle. >>> >>> I suspect that it is a refresh issue with the select widget, but I'd >>> like to be able to reproduce it so that I can investigate. >>> >>> Best wishes >>> >>> Jeremy. >>> >>> >>> >>> On Thu, Apr 9, 2015 at 9:44 PM, Roma Hicks <[email protected]> wrote: >>> >>>> The $action name definitely needs changing, it is a vestige of its >>>> original design, until I made the widget more generic keep forgetting to >>>> write it down though. >>>> >>>> Okay, just tried something that changes the issue a bit.
